Twist Technology Viet Nam LTD Address: 7th Floor, Me Linh Point Tower Building, No 2, Ngo Duc Ke Street, Ben Nghe Ward, District 1, Ho Chi Minh City Enterprise code: 0318113340 Phone: 02379887706 Representative: Munemoto Yuta Ben Nghe Ward, District 1, Ho Chi Minh CityFounding date: 20 - 10 - 2023